A safari that is a part of authentic, sustainable, ethical and unique travel is an arduous task. It requires research and thoughtful consideration. Here are twenty tips to help you find safari trips that emphasize culture immersion, responsible travel, and excursions off the beaten track:
Unique and authentic travel experiences
Pick less well-known parks: opt for parks such as South Luangwa (Zambia) or Mana Pools (Zimbabwe) for an personal safari experience.
Private Conservancies. You can stay in reserves which are close to national Parks for an exclusive nature experience, and with fewer visitors.
Night Safaris: Search for packages that include night drives to see wildlife that are nocturnal.
Walking Safaris: For an even more immersive experience take a walk through the woods with a guide.
Cultural Safaris: Combine wildlife watching with visits to local communities like the Maasai or San in Botswana.
Responsible Tourism and Ethical Travel
Beware of animal cruelty. Make sure that the safari company doesn’t promote activities such as elephant riding or hunting in canned food.
Fair Wages: Be sure that all trackers, guides and staff receive fair wages, and are working in safe surroundings.
Respect Wildlife: Select operators who follow ethical wildlife viewing techniques, such as keeping a safe distance away from wildlife and avoiding disturbing them.
Transparency: Pick companies that are open about the methods they use and how these benefits local communities.
Cultural Sensitivity: Learn about and be respectful of local customs and traditions.

Japan is a diverse country that caters to different travel styles like solo travelers and honeymooners, foodies, and adrenaline lovers. Here are 20 ways to create unforgettable holiday experiences in Japan, tailored to different travel styles:
Solo Travelers
Tokyo’s Neighborhoods: Take a look at diverse neighborhoods like Shibuya Shinjuku Asakusa. Each offers a unique vibe with bustling streets and ancient temples.
Capsule Hotels – Getting a stay in a hotel capsule can be an affordable and modern method of traveling.
Individual travelers can indulge in ramen, sushi as well as other dishes that are counter-style.
Hiking Kumano Kodo: Explore the ancient path of pilgrimage to enjoy an enthralling mix of the natural world, historical significance and peace.
Join language cafes to learn an additional language in cities like Osaka or Kyoto.
Unique Experiences
Robot Restaurant (Tokyo), a futuristic, quirky show unlike any other anywhere else.
Snow Monkeys Nagano Visit Jigokudani Monkey Park and see wild monkeys bathing at hot springs.
Explore the contemporary art installations on this tiny island in the Seto Inland Sea.
Overnight in a temple (Koyasan). Stay in a Buddhist Temple to experience the life of a monk, which includes vegetarian meals and meditation.
Fox Village (Miyagi). Visit Zao Fox Village to interact with thousands and hundreds of free-roaming, wild foxes.
Honeymoon Destinations
Hakone, Japan: Relax at a private onsen.
Luxury Ryokan – Stay in an inn which offers Japanese meal (multi-course meals) as well as a personal service.
Okinawa’s beach: soak up the tropical vibes of Ishigaki island or Miyako.
Sapporo Snow Festival: Visit in winter to experience romantic snowy landscapes and Ice sculptures.
Kyoto Bamboo Forest. Stroll through Arashiyama Bamboo Grove.
Adrenaline Adventures
Niseko is a world-class powder ski and snowboarding spot.
White-Water Rafting in Minakami: Rapids and scenic sceneries in a river.
Climb Mount Fuji: Tackle Japan’s iconic peak during the climbing season (July-September).
Bungee jumping at Ryujin Suspension Bridge one of Japan’s top jumping bungee jumps.
Surfing in Shonan – Ride the waves in popular surf spots close to Tokyo including Enoshima.
Cultural Immersion
Kyoto Tea Ceremony: Take part in the Japanese tradition of tea ceremonies.
Geisha Performances Gion’s historical district is the home of the geisha and maiko performance.
Samurai Experience Tokyo: Learn about the history of swordsmanship among samurais and dress up like one.
Festivals (Matsuri ) Participate in local festivals such as Gion Matsuri or Nebuta Matsuri.
Pottery Arita: Make your own traditional Japanese ceramics.
Chilled-Out Retreats
Onsen towns (Beppu and Kusatsu) Get a taste of the natural hot springs and stunning views.
Shirakawago: Stay a traditional thatched farmhouse within UNESCO World Heritage.
Izu Peninsula, enjoy the coastal scenery and hot springs.
Lake Kawaguchi: Relax by the lake while enjoying views of Mount Fuji.
Yakushima Island, Japan: Explore lush forests and serene trails for hiking.
Foodie Delights
Osaka’s Street Food Try takoyaki (octopus balls) and the okonomiyaki (savory pancakes) in Dotonbori.
Tsukiji Market offers fresh, delicious sushi.
Fukuoka Ramen, the origin of Hakata Ramen.
Wagyu Beef in Kobe Indulge in the finest Kobe beef in a premium restaurant.
Sake Brewery Tours Visit breweries to find out about sake in Niigata or Kyoto.
Safari and Wildlife
African Safari in Japan (Safari Park) Visit Kyushu African Safari for the chance to view Giraffes, lions, and elephants in close proximity.
Dolphin Watching at Mikurajima. You can swim and watch dolphins.
Shiretoko National Park (Hokkaido) is one of the most remote parks where you can spot brown bears.
Whale Watching in Okinawa: See humpback whales during the winter months.
Turtle nesting on Ogasawara island See sea turtles nesting at remote beaches.
